Common causes There are many patients with back pain, and the common cause is local bone or soft tissue disease of the back. Other pains include pain reflected from organ diseases to the back or pain caused by tumors in other parts of the body metastasizing to the back. 2. Characteristics of back pain caused by respiratory diseases: ① Local pain is accompanied by respiratory symptoms and signs. ② Pain related to breathing is often seen in cases of pleural lesions. ③ Check that there is no lesion in the spine, no restriction of movement, and no local tenderness. ④ Chest imaging examination may reveal lung or pleural lesions. 3. Characteristics of back pain caused by circulatory system diseases: ① Pain behind the sternum or in front of the heart, which may radiate to the shoulder. ② It is often triggered or aggravated by physical activity and improves after rest. ③ Chest and shoulder pain is often transient and can be quickly improved or eliminated by using cardiovascular dilators and oxygen inhalation. ④ During an attack, electrocardiogram examination may reveal myocardial ischemic changes. 4. Digestive system diseases Many digestive system diseases can cause back pain. Characteristics: ① Each organ disease has a fixed reflex site. For example, biliary colic often reflects to the left chest and back, so biliary colic in the elderly is easily misdiagnosed as coronary heart disease. Pancreatic disease often reflects to the left lower back. Gastric and duodenal tumors or penetrating ulcers often reflect to the middle part of the posterior chest and back. ②Pain attacks are often related to dietary factors. ③Ultrasound and gastrointestinal angiography can confirm the diagnosis. |
